If you’re into croissants, creamy fillings, and all things pistachio, Lapisan Pâtisserie just gave you a reason to visit Salon Du Pain 2025. From 21 May to 8 June, head over to Isetan KLCC to try their two new exclusive creations both inspired by this year’s festival theme: pistachio.
Salon Du Pain, one of Kuala Lumpur’s most awaited artisan bread and pastry festivals, brings together the crème de la crème of local and regional pâtissiers. This year, Lapisan’s bold new treats aim to satisfy both pastry purists and sweet tooths alike.
🥐 Meet the Stars: Pistachio Bowtie Croissant and Cronelé
The first showstopper is the Pistachio Bowtie Croissant. It’s shaped like a ribbon, with buttery flaky layers and a generous filling of pistachio cream. Every bite balances crunch and cream, giving you that melt-in-your-mouth richness with a nutty twist.
Right next to it? The Pistachio Cronelé a mash-up of croissant and canelé. It features the chewy bite and caramelised edges of a classic canelé but filled with velvety sweet pistachio cream. It's buttery, rich, and perfect for those who like their dessert with depth.

🌿 Halal Certified and Proud
Earlier this year, Lapisan Pâtisserie’s Mid Valley outlet earned its Halal certification from the Department of Islamic Development Malaysia (JAKIM). This certification makes their creations more accessible to a wider Malaysian audience, including Muslim dessert lovers looking for halal-certified French-inspired treats.
